Cargo Features
[dependencies]
mpi = { version = "0.8.0", default-features = false, features = ["user-operations", "derive", "complex"] }
- default = user-operations
-
The
user-operations
feature is set by default whenevermpi
is added without
somewhere in the dependency tree.default-features = false - user-operations default = libffi
-
Affects
collective::UserOperation
… - derive = memoffset, mpi-derive
-
Affects
datatype::internal.check_derive_equivalence_universe_state
… - complex
-
Enables num-complex
Affects
datatype::complex_datatype
…
Features from optional dependencies
In crates that don't use the dep:
syntax, optional dependencies automatically become Cargo features. These features may have been created by mistake, and this functionality may be removed in the future.
- libffi user-operations
- memoffset derive?
-
Enables memoffset
used by complex_datatype, which does not use "derive" feature
- mpi-derive derive?